First Aid Courses
ACCESS is delighted to share that we are offering English language First Aid Skills Training courses in The Hague and Amsterdam. Open to all who would like to learn or brush up on their First Aid skills and of particular value for parents of young children. The Training
Linda Malley has been providing this course to and through many organisations in the Netherlands. The feedback is impressive, as is the knowledge she shares. Ingrid Gustafsson-Hilberink is Registered General Nurse working at the British School in Leidschenveen, and is familiar with the challenges in a family. Among the topics covered are: caring for unresponsive breathing casualties; CPR; choking; wounds; bleeding; shock and seizures. Some hands-on examples of what to do with minor injuries – sprains and strains; head injury; burns, bites and stings, severe allergic reaction; heat exhaustion and asthma, will also be covered.
The Trainers
Linda Bosma-Malley trained as a Registered General Nurse in the UK, specialising in Paediatrics. Having worked in Neurology as a nurse in the Netherlands and as a First Aid Trainer during her family’s time in South Africa, Linda understands the importance of providing people with the skills and confidence to respond effectively to accidents or sudden illness. Linda is a registered and certified First Aid Trainer, qualified to teach and assess a full range of first aid courses.
Ingrid had a varied background, before becoming a psychiatric nurse for children for 10 years. She has lived in Sweden, Dubai and Portugal. And has been in the Netherlands since 2015.
Both are dedicated to teaching people the necessary skills that can make the difference when it really counts.

The Courses
Emergency First Aid – 10 ways to save a life – 3hrs – €75 per person (includes VAT)
Ten things all first aiders should know. This course covers a variety of emergency and basic first aid, for all age groups, adults, children and babies. You gain skills and knowledge, plus essential hands on practice on the following topics:
- Unresponsive
- The Recovery Position
- CPR and using an AED
- Choking
- Seizures, fits, febrile convulsions
- Wounds, bleeding & shock
- Burns & Scalds
- Strains & Sprains
- Bites & Stings (in the summer months), poisoning (in the winter months)
- Head injuries
